- 1、本文档共5页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
帝国 cms 修改列表式分页模板教程发布
今天发布一个帝国 cms 修改列表式分页模板教程,希望对这方面不熟悉的人喜欢
帝国 cms 没有内置后台修改列表式分页模板,所以需要修改 php 文件
因为很多新手对 Php 不怎么了解,所以今天发布一个列表式分页模板修改教程,教大家修改个性风格的列表式分页模板
首先解释一下,使用我的这个方法修改列表页模板不会导致帝国 cms 不正常,
因为使用了自定义函数,跟帝国原函数文件 t_funciton.php 分离的,所以请大家方向照着我的方法做
下面进入修改列表模板正题:
第一步:进入帝国 cms 后台,点击系统设置-信息设置:里面有个列表分页函数(列表)选项,将里面的函数名修改为 user_ShowListMorePage
第二部:复制 t_function.php 列表式分页代码到 e/class/userfun.php ?php ? 之间或者复制以下代码也行
[code]
function user_ShowListMorePage($num,$page,$dolink,$type,$totalpage,$line,$ok,$search=){ global $fun_r,$public_r;
if($num=$line)
{
$pager[showpage]=;
{
{
return $pager;
}
$page_line=$public_r[listpagelistnum];
$snum=2;
$totalpage=ceil($num/$line);//取得总页数
$firststr=span 总 数 strong.$num./strong/ 共 /strongstrong .$totalpage./strong/span; // $num 意思是信息总数 $totalpage 代表总页数
// 上一页if($page1)
{
$toppage=li class=nexta href=.$dolink.index.$type..$fun_r[startpage]./a/li; // 首页
$pagepr=$1; if($pagepr==1)
{
$prido=index.$type;
}
else
$prido=index_.$pagepr.$type;
}
$prepage=li class=nexta href=.$dolink.$prido..$fun_r[pripage]./a/li; // 上
一页
}
// 下一页if($page!=$totalpage)
{
$pagenex=$page+1;
$nextpage=li class=nexta href=.$dolink.index_.$pagenex.$type..$fun_r[nextpage]./a/li; // 下一页
$lastpage=li class=lastlya href=.$dolink.index_.$totalpage.$type..$fun_r[lastpage]./a/li; // 最后一页
}
$starti=$$snum1?1:$$snum;
$no=0;
for($i=$starti;$i=$totalpage$no$page_line;$i++) // 详细页码信息
{
$no++; if($page==$i)
{
$is_1=li class=active; // 当前
$is_2=/li;
}
elseif($i==1)
$is_1=lia href=.$dolink.index.$type.; // 第一页
$is_2=/a/li;
}
else
{
$is_1=lia href=.$dolink.index_.$i.$type.; // 其他页
$is_2=/a/li;
}
$returnstr.=$is_1.$i.$is_2;
}
$returnstr=div id=splitpage.$firststr.uln.$toppage.n.$prepage.n.$returnstr.n.$nextpage.n.$lastpage
./ul/div;
$pager[showpage]=$returnstr; return $pager;
}
[/code]
第三步:
修改 php 代码需要注意的在包含的代码中不能用,只能用 , 建议大家直接修改,html 不用加双引号和单引号也行,不会出现任何问题
如果有 php 相关编译软件,可将代码复制进入修改,不但提高效率还能检测错误
其中主要修改地方是$returnstr 变量,在最后面,在以上代码大家可以看到我写的相关标签,如果自己懂得不多,可以先把我写的 html 标签和 class,id 变成自己的
不用全部修改
还要前面
您可能关注的文档
- 辞退员工补偿申请书怎么写.docx
- 慈弘书香伴我成长五年级作文.docx
- 慈溪市第四实验小学.docx
- 搭配练习题 分析和总结.docx
- 搭石 课内阅读题.docx
- 搭石课堂教学实录.docx
- 打高一初、高中化学衔接课教案、学案.docx
- 打工好还是学手艺好.docx
- 打击假冒特种作业操作证专项治理行动月报表.docx
- 打架的危害德育活动课教案分析.docx
- 高速排水型船舶兴波波形及尾浪数值计算:方法、影响与应用.docx
- 海事法院拍卖船舶引起的确权诉讼:理论、实践与展望.docx
- 第一课 时代精神的精华 同步练习 高中政治统编版必修四哲学与文化.docx
- 《当代国际政治与经济》 综合练习(含解析)2025年高考政治政治二轮复习模块专练(统编版).docx
- 第四课 探索认识的奥秘 同步练习 高中政治统编版必修四哲学与文化.docx
- 第三单元 文化传承与文化创新 单元检测 高中政治统编版必修四哲学与文化.docx
- 《政治与法治》 综合练习 (含解析)2025年高考政治政治二轮复习模块专练(统编版).docx
- 河南省郑州市2025年高中毕业年级第一次质量预测思想政治试卷(含答案).docx
- 河南省漯河市郾城区2024-2025学年九年级上学期1月期末道德与法治试题(含答案).pdf
- 湖北省武汉市江汉区2025年中考语文模拟试卷(含解析).pdf
文档评论(0)